Ross Thornhill started this petition to Torbay Town Council

The Town of Torbay, NL is comprised of a mixture of homes who have their own private well and homes who are connected to the Town's water supply. The water supply originates at North Pond and is supplied to the homes through a pump house located adjacent to the pond. A water treatment plant is required to improve the overall quality of the water being supplied to the residents. However currently some residents have clear water and report no issues, whereas some residents report intermittent issues throughout the year and some residents have constant issues. The worse supply problems result in constant brown water being supplied to the homes, this results in appliance failure, early hot water tank replacement and undrinkable water. These local issues are thought to be a result of poor design and aging infrastructure and have been ongoing in some cases for 10-15 years. It is time for the Town Council of Torbay to investigate, find the causes and implement a repair plan.
